Application Description

Monitor specific HYUNDAI parameters by adding the Advanced LT plugin to Torque Pro, enabling real-time monitoring of engine and automatic transmission advanced sensor data.

Advanced LT is a plugin designed for Torque Pro that expands the PID/Sensor list with specific parameters tailored for HYUNDAI vehicles. You can try the plugin with a limited set of sensors before deciding to purchase. Please note that this version does not include calculated sensors such as Injector Duty Cycle (%) or HIVEC mode.

PLEASE NOTE that while other HYUNDAI models/engines may be supported, the plugin has been tested on the following models/engines:

The plugin also features an ECU Scanner, which is invaluable for identifying specific sensors on HYUNDAI engines not yet supported by the plugin. To utilize this feature, you need to record at least 1000 samples and send the logs to the developer.

Advanced LT requires the latest version of Torque Pro to function properly. It is NOT a standalone application and will NOT work without Torque Pro.

Plugin Installation

  1. After downloading the plugin from Google Play, ensure it appears in your Android device's installed applications list.
  2. Launch Torque Pro and click on the "Advanced LT" icon.
  3. Select the appropriate engine type and return to the Torque Pro main screen.
  4. Navigate to Torque Pro "Settings".
  5. Confirm the plugin is listed in Torque Pro by going to "Settings" > "Plugins" > "Installed Plugins".
  6. Scroll down to "Manage extra PIDs/Sensors".
  7. This screen typically won't display any entries unless you've previously added pre-defined or custom PIDs.
  8. From the menu, select "Add predefined set".
  9. Ensure you choose the correct set for your HYUNDAI engine type.
  10. After selecting the appropriate entry, additional entries should appear on the Extra PIDs/Sensors list.

Adding Displays

  1. Once you've added the additional sensors, go to the Realtime Information/Dashboard.
  2. Press the menu key and then click on "Add Display".
  3. Choose the appropriate display type (Dial, Bar, Graph, Digital Display, etc.).
  4. Select the appropriate sensor from the list. Sensors provided by Advanced LT are prefixed with "[HADV]" and should be listed right after the time sensors at the top of the list.
